Kintyre Way seeks new trustees
The Kintyre Way is looking for new trustees to help the popular walking route make strides into 2022 and beyond.
Despite the two-year long restrictions imposed by Covid, the route's popularity has not waned and it remains one of Argyll's best-loved tourist attractions.
The Kintyre Way has been proactive in raising much-needed funds to ensure maintenance projects can continue to be carried out on the 100-mile route from Tarbert to Campbeltown.
Friends of the Kintyre Way, meanwhile, is made up of volunteers who monitor the route and carry out smaller maintenance tasks, and supporters of the Kintyre Way can help fund this work through donations.
A group spokesperson said: ‘We're looking for enthusiastic go-getters in all regions of Kintyre - innovators who can use their passion and expertise to improve the Kintyre Way.'
